Carry out group diversity activities. Incorporating diversity exercises and activities into group activities fosters a sense of belonging. The flower petal activity might be one of the workplace diversity activities. Each group creates a flower with petals and writes a characteristic unique to each member on each petal.

WebJun 17, 2024 · Promoting Inclusion in Youth Sports Embodying inclusion demands that no one is excluded or required to face additional rules or scrutiny to fairly and fully participate. Inclusive behaviors in youth sports provide opportunities and options to kids of all backgrounds, ages and abilities. WebThe opposite of Inclusion, is literally Exclusion. Let's talk.
